Output 58df5065fde56a4cd5b59f1a3d4082f03d11c0fce15d32338b371397f1fa7310:7

value
1631915
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44aa1f13b4d35847aabb923802fe053d8d8c6036 OP_EQUALVERIFY OP_CHECKSIG
address
17G4kHbhdee5UNFWxbyajSnP2oVdM49rbF
transaction
58df5065fde56a4cd5b59f1a3d4082f03d11c0fce15d32338b371397f1fa7310
confirmations
415719
spent
true